import { AuthRequiredError, EmptyResultError, selectorError } from '@jackwener/opencli/errors';
|
|
import { cli, Strategy } from '@jackwener/opencli/registry';
|
|
/**
|
|
* band mentions — Show Band notifications where you were @mentioned.
|
|
*
|
|
* Band.us signs every API request with a per-request HMAC (`md` header) generated
|
|
* by its own JavaScript, so we cannot replicate it externally. Instead we use
|
|
* Strategy.INTERCEPT: install an XHR interceptor, open the notification panel by
|
|
* clicking the bell to trigger the get_news XHR call, then apply client-side
|
|
* filtering to extract notifications matching the requested filter/unread options.
|
|
*/
